1 million: The number of background checks Checkr runs per month.

97 percent: The number of organizations that report a cyberattack on their IoT devices would be catastrophic.

$100 million: The amount gig economy background-checking startup Checkr raised in Series C funding.

27 percent: The share of organizations that have secured their IoT devices.

0 seconds: The amount of time a fraud bot spends browsing before making a purchase.
